Sulindac

Composition

Contains Sulindac, a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) that inhibits cyclooxygenase (COX) enzymes.

Indications

Used to treat pain and inflammation in conditions like os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and acute gout.

Side effects

Gastrointestinal upset, headache, dizziness, rash, potential risk of gastrointestinal bleeding.

Precautions

Use with caution in patients with gastrointestinal ulcers, renal impairment, or cardiovascular disease; monitor for signs of bleeding.

Contraindications

Known hypersensitivity to sulindac or other NSAIDs, history of asthma exacerbated by NSAIDs, active gastrointestinal bleeding.

Dosage and administration

Typical adult dose: 150–200 mg twice daily, adjusted per response and tolerance.
